Among the these detectors, probably the most economical and well known solutions are UV and refractive index (RI) detectors. They may have relatively broad selectivity reasonable detection boundaries more often than not. The RI detector was the initial detector available for business use.

The existing flowing between the Functioning electrode as well as the auxiliary electrode serves since the analytical sign. Detection limits for amperometric electrochemical detection are from 10 pg–1 ng of injected analyte.

The HPLC pump drives the solvent and sample in the column. To lessen variation while in the elution, the pump should retain a constant, pulse totally free, move amount; That is accomplished with multi-piston pumps. The presence of two pistons makes it possible for the movement price to become controlled by one particular piston as the opposite recharges.
